This is limited edition 2013 gold proof fifty pence coin marks the 100th Anniversary of the Birth of Benjamin Britten, the iconic English composer. Struck in 22 carat gold fineness, this is one of only 150 coins minted.
Proof coins are struck using specially prepared dies and highly polished blanks. This produces a high quality finish with a beautifully defined engraving. The 2013 Benjamin Britten gold proof fifty pence comes in the original Royal Mint presentation box with a numbered certificate of authenticity.
Born in November 1913, Benjamin Britten wrote around 75 hours of music, a remarkable and wide range of work ranging across many different moods and genres. His talents as a conductor and pianist were also well recognised. Even after his death which was in 1976 his reputation as one of the greatest musicans has lived on.
Gold proof fifty pences are often issued with low mintages which makes them highly desireable to coin collectors. The fifty pence is British legal tender and is exempt from Capital Gains Tax.

The obverse bears the fourth definitive UK coin portrait of Elizabeth II by Ian Rank-Broadley and the inscription ELIZABETH ·II·D·G REG·F·D·2013
The reverse of the coin bears an engraving by Tom Phillips with the inscription BLOW BUGLE BLOW and SET THE WILD ECHOES FLYING from the poet, Lord Tennyson. The composer's name BENJAMIN BRITTEN is in a double musical staff with COMPOSER · BORN 1913 positioned between.
